Abstract

An electrically variable transmission has a pair of clutches and a first mode when the first clutch is applied and the second clutch released, a second mode when the second clutch is applied and the first clutch released, and a fixed-ratio mode when both clutches are applied. Upshifts and downshifts out of fixed-ratio are accomplished in accordance with a control based upon shift confidence factors determined in accordance with proportional and derivative input speed error quantities. Additional authority limits are placed upon the shift confidence factors in accordance with output speed derivative quantities. Additional override downshift control is provided in accordance with additional input speed condition determinations.

Claims (25)

1. Method for scheduling shifts from a fixed-ratio mode to first and second modes in an electrically variable transmission including an input member and an output member, first and second clutches, said first mode characterized by simultaneous first clutch application and second clutch release, said second mode characterized by simultaneous first clutch release and second clutch application, said fixed-ratio mode characterized by simultaneous first and second clutch applications wherein the transmission input member is mechanically coupled to the transmission output member through a predetermined fixed ratio, comprising:

calculating a first signal as the difference between a desired input member speed and an actual input member speed;

calculating a second signal as the time rate of change of the first signal; and

calculating a third signal as the time rate of change of an output member speed;

scheduling shifts in accordance with shift confidence factors determined as functions of the first, second and third signals wherein shifts into the first mode are scheduled in accordance with a first shift confidence factor and shifts into the second mode are scheduled in accordance with a second shift confidence factor; and,

wherein the first shift confidence factor generally trends larger when the first and second signals are positive and generally trends smaller when the first and second signals are negative, and the second shift confidence factor generally trends smaller when the first and second signals are positive and generally trends larger when the first and second signals are negative.

2. Method for scheduling shifts as claimed in claim 1 wherein the trending of the first and second shift confidence factors is attenuated as a function of the third signal.

3. Method for scheduling shifts as claimed in claim 1 wherein the trending of the first shift confidence factor only is attenuated when the third signal is positive and the second shift confidence factor only is attenuated when the third signal is negative.

4. Method for scheduling shifts from a fixed-ratio mode to first and second modes in an electrically variable transmission including an input member and an output member, first and second clutches, said first mode characterized by simultaneous first clutch application and second clutch release, said second mode characterized by simultaneous first clutch release and second clutch application, said fixed-ratio mode characterized by simultaneous first and second clutch applications wherein the transmission input member is mechanically coupled to the transmission output member through a predetermined fixed ratio, comprising:

calculating a first signal as the difference between a desired input member speed and an actual input member speed;

calculating a second signal as the time rate of change of the first signal;

calculating a third signal as the time rate of change of an output member speed; and,

scheduling shifts in accordance with shift confidence factors determined as functions of the first, second and third signals;

wherein shifts to the first mode are scheduled when the actual input member speed falls below a predetermined minimum threshold speed and falls below the desired input speed by a predetermined amount.

5. Method for scheduling shifts from a fixed-ratio mode to first and second modes in an electrically variable transmission including an input member and an output member, first and second clutches, said first mode characterized by simultaneous first clutch application and second clutch release, said second mode characterized by simultaneous first clutch release and second clutch application, said fixed-ratio mode characterized by simultaneous first and second clutch applications wherein the transmission input member is mechanically coupled to the transmission output member through a predetermined fixed ratio, comprising:

calculating a first signal as the difference between a desired input member speed and an actual input member speed;

calculating a second signal as the time rate of change of the first signal; and

scheduling shifts in accordance with shift confidence factors determined as functions of the first and second signals.

6. Method for scheduling shifts as claimed in claim 5 further comprising:

calculating a third signal as the time rate of change of an output member speed; and,

scheduling shifts in accordance with shift confidence factors determined as functions of the first, second and third signals.

7. Method for scheduling shifts as claimed in claim 6 wherein scheduling shifts into the first mode is in accordance with a first shift confidence factor and scheduling shifts into the second mode is in accordance with a second shift confidence factor.

8. Method for scheduling shifts as claimed in claim 5 wherein:

the shift confidence factors are incremented as a function of a) the first signal and b) the second signal; and,

shifts are scheduled when the shift confidence factors attain predetermined thresholds.
